WET TRACKS FORCE RESCHEDULING OF RACE MEETINGS

Wet weather has disrupted the north coast horse racing calendar.
The meeting planned for Monday in Coffs Harbour has been rescheduled, after the city received more than 200-millimetres of rain in 48 hours.
With no prospect of the track drying out before then, racing officials transferred the meeting to Grafton.
Today’s Grafton meeting was also abandoned but the track there is expected to be ready for racing come Monday.
